The Makita XCV09Z is a cordless backpack dry vacuum powered by two 18V LXT batteries for 36V performance, designed for contractors, cleaning crews, and construction pros needing portable dust extraction between small onboard systems and bulky canister vacs.
Its brushless motor delivers 70 CFM suction and 44 inches of water lift, excelling at pulling fine construction dust from tools like saws or sanders, while the HEPA filter captures allergens for safer air quality. On job sites, it handles drywall dust or wood shavings effectively without cords slowing you down.
At 9.9 lbs with batteries, the ergonomic backpack harness with padded straps and waist belt distributes weight evenly for comfortable stair climbing or overhead work, and the waist-mounted power controller allows one-handed operation. Build quality feels pro-grade with durable components built for daily abuse.
Drawbacks include the small half-gallon capacity requiring more frequent dumps on heavy debris days and no wet pickup capability, plus batteries are extra for non-Makita owners.
Buy this if you're in construction or professional cleaning needing cordless portability; skip it for home use or if you need larger capacity or wet-dry versatility.
Brushless Motor (70 CFM, 44" Water Lift): Provides strong, consistent suction for quick dust pickup from tools, running cooler to extend runtime and motor life on long jobs.
HEPA Two-Stage Filter: Captures 99.97% of 0.3-micron particles, protecting lungs from fine dust and prolonging the main filter's life for fewer replacements.
Cordless 36V Power (Two 18V Batteries): Delivers up to 116 minutes on normal or 33 minutes on max, freeing you from outlets for uninterrupted cleaning in large spaces.
Backpack Design (9.9 lbs): Padded straps and 39-inch flexible hose with telescoping wand enable hands-free mobility and extended reach for hard-to-access areas.
Disposable Dust Bags: Simplify emptying without messy clouds of dust, saving time and keeping your workspace cleaner.

The Makita XCV17PG is a professional-grade 36V (18V X2) brushless cordless backpack dry vacuum with 1.6-gallon capacity and HEPA filtration, designed for cleaning crews and construction dust extraction systems.
Its brushless motor delivers 78 CFM suction and 44 inches of water lift, excelling at pulling fine drywall dust from surfaces or extracting from power tools on job sites, while the cordless setup avoids cord drag during mobile cleanups.
At 15 pounds with batteries, the ergonomic backpack harness with padded straps and waist belt ensures balanced comfort for hours of use, and the removable half-gallon dust container simplifies emptying without mess.
Drawbacks include shorter 40-minute runtime on high power and dry-only functionality, which limits versatility compared to wet-dry models, plus the need for compatible Makita 18V batteries.
Buy this if you're a pro cleaner or contractor needing portable, high-suction dust control; skip it for basic home use where lighter stick vacs suffice.
BL Brushless Motor: Provides 78 CFM suction and 44-inch water lift for rapid debris removal, running cooler to handle prolonged jobs without performance drop.
HEPA Filter System: Traps 99.97% of 0.3-micron particles with a two-stage setup, improving air quality and reducing filter clogs for fewer maintenance stops.
Extended Runtime: Up to 139 minutes on low with two 6.0Ah batteries, enabling full-site cleanups without constant recharging.
Backpack Design: Padded straps and waist belt make it hands-free and comfortable, with a waist-mounted power controller for easy speed adjustments on the go.
Star Protection: Real-time battery monitoring prevents overheating or over-discharge, maximizing reliability in demanding pro environments.

The Prolux 2.0 is a cordless backpack vacuum tailored for professional cleaners and small business owners who clean homes, offices, and stairs regularly, offering hands-free operation without cords or bags.
Key features like 75 CFM suction and specialized tools excel on hard floors and low-pile carpets, quickly handling pet hair under furniture or dust on hardwood without scattering. The 1.5-inch hose and telescoping wand make tight spaces and high spots accessible in real-world scenarios like apartment maintenance or office quick cleans.
At 11 pounds with plush adjustable straps, it distributes weight to the hips for back-friendly use during all-day jobs, while the bagless bin and HEPA filtration ensure easy maintenance and allergen reduction. Build quality feels sturdy for commercial light use, with quick battery swaps for minimal downtime.
Limitations include weaker performance on plush carpets or heavy debris, where corded models with more power outperform it. Buy this if you prioritize cordless speed for low-pile and hard surfaces; skip for deep-cleaning thick carpets.
Cordless with 1-Hour Runtime: Two swappable 35-minute batteries and fast charger let you clean large areas without plugs, boosting speed by avoiding cord swaps.
Lightweight 11-lb Bagless Design: Easy to carry up stairs and empty dirt with one push, eliminating bag costs and heavy lifting for daily convenience.
75 CFM Suction and Tools: Handles low-pile carpets and hard floors efficiently with crevice, upholstery, duster, and floor tools, reaching under furniture fast.
3-Stage HEPA Filtration: Cyclonic, micron, and HEPA stages trap allergens for fresher air and less dusting after cleans.
Adjustable Comfort Straps: Plush padding shifts weight to waist, reducing fatigue on long professional jobs.

The ProTeam GoFit 3 is a compact 3-quart cordless backpack vacuum designed for commercial cleaners seeking cordless freedom in hotels, offices, or schools, especially those with smaller builds or new to backpack styles.
Its 4Ah battery powers through hardwood floors and low-pile carpets effectively on high, picking up pet hair and debris quickly, while low mode extends runtime for detail work like baseboards. The Xover telescoping wand and multi-surface tools excel at transitioning from floors to upholstery without swapping attachments often.
At 12.8 pounds with battery, the durable build and brushless motor handle daily professional use, with the tool-free FlexFit harness distributing weight evenly for hours of comfort. HEPA filtration traps allergens reliably, improving air quality in dust-prone areas.
Drawbacks include shorter 39-minute high-power runtime for expansive jobs and a learning curve for harness fit. Buy this if you need lightweight cordless mobility for mid-sized commercial spaces; skip for small homes favoring push vacuums.
Cordless Operation: Move freely without cords, cleaning 30% faster in cord-restricted areas like stairwells or crowded events.
4Ah Battery with Power Switch: Delivers 51 minutes on low for efficiency or 39 on high for tough messes, with 61-minute recharge to sustain workflows.
Lightweight 12.8 lb Design: Eases strain during all-day use, perfect for smaller users navigating multi-floor buildings.
FlexFit Harness: Quick-adjust straps fit diverse body types tool-free, promoting comfort and reducing back fatigue.
ProLevel HEPA Filtration: Captures fine particles and allergens, preventing re-release for cleaner air in sensitive environments.
Xover Tool Kit: Telescoping wand and multi-tools handle floors, crevices, and upholstery, saving time on attachment changes.

Suction Power and Cleaning Performance
Suction power in cordless backpack vacuums is measured in air watts or pascals, typically ranging from 100 to 200 air watts for strong performance. Higher suction excels at picking up dust, crumbs, and pet hair on hardwood, tile, or low-pile carpet. In real-world tests, models with brushless motors maintain power without fading, unlike brushed ones that lose strength over time.
Look for cyclonic technology to separate debris and sustain airflow. Red flags include vague specs like just Horsepower without airflow data, which often means weak real cleaning. For cluttered homes, prioritize adjustable suction modes to balance power and battery life.
Battery Life and Runtime
Battery runtime varies from 20 to 60 minutes per charge, enough for apartments or whole homes depending on suction level. Lithium-ion batteries in 2026 models recharge faster and hold power better across temperatures. Real-life use like daily maintenance or post-party cleanups demands quick recharge and resume capability.
Avoid models under 30 minutes unless for spot cleaning. Pair with extra batteries for large areas, and check compatibility with existing tool systems like 18V platforms for cost savings.
Capacity and Filtration Systems
Backpack tanks range from 0.5 to 2 gallons, holding more debris for fewer empties during big jobs. HEPA (High Efficiency Particulate Air) filters trap 99.97% of particles as small as 0.3 microns down to 0.3 microns, ideal for allergy sufferers or dusty workshops. Bagless designs empty easily outdoors, but look for washable filters to cut maintenance costs.
In pet-heavy homes, multi-stage filtration prevents clogs from hair. Common mistake: Ignoring filter status lights, leading to suction loss mid-clean.
Weight and Ergonomics
Lightweight builds under 12 pounds reduce back strain during stairs or overhead cleaning. Padded harnesses with adjustable straps distribute weight evenly, like wearing a comfortable daypack. Models with swivel harnesses pivot for better reach under furniture.
For busy users, test fit in stores if possible. Heavier pro-grade units offer more capacity but tire you faster in homes versus commercial spaces.
Accessories and Versatility
Key tools include crevice nozzles for tight spots, floor wands for broad areas, and upholstery brushes for sofas. Telescoping wands extend reach without stretching. On-board storage keeps everything handy, avoiding lost attachments.
Versatile kits handle dry messes best; some add wet pickup for spills. Practical tip: Choose combo kits for cars, stairs, and garages in one vacuum.
Noise Level and Daily Use
Quiet operation under 70 decibels allows daytime cleaning without disturbing family. Variable speed controls drop noise for quick touch-ups. In shared homes, low-decibel modes make routine pet hair pickup feasible anytime.
Louder models suit workshops but annoy indoors. Always check user feedback on real noise versus specs.
Maintenance and Durability
Easy-empty tanks and tool-free filter access speed upkeep. Brushless motors last longer with less wear. Rugged builds withstand job site drops, key for pros.
Tip: Rinse filters monthly and store batteries charged. Avoid cheap plastics that crack over time.
